Adjusting On-Screen Displays – Setup Menu
1. Press qp buttons on the remote or CH+/CH- on the TV) to move the cursor to the item to be selected.
2. Press t u buttons on the remote or VOL+/VOL- on the TV to make the desired adjustments.
3. When your adjustments are complete, press MENU or EXIT on the remote or MENU on the TV to exit the main menu.
Menu Language
Press the qp buttons to highlight Menu Language, then use
t u to select English, French or Spanish.
Transparent
Press the qp buttons to highlight Transparent, then use
t u to select to what degree the picture shows through the
on-screen menus: 0%, 25%, 50%, 75% or 100%. At 0%, none of
the underlying picture will show through the menus.
Closed Caption
This option appears only when TV is selected as the source.
Press the qp buttons to highlight Closed Caption, then use
t u to enter the CC Mode submenu shown at left. Pressing t
u will now select among the three closed caption modes: O,
On and CC on Mute. The last option shows captions only when
mute is activated.
Restore Default
Press the qp buttons to highlight Restore Default, then use
t u to bring up the Restore Default submenu. Press t to
restore the TV to factory settings, press u to cancel.

Setup Wizard
Press the qp buttons to highlight Setup Wizard, then use
t u to start the Setup Wizard. You will see the rst of four
submenus, all of which are shown at left. The Setup Wizard
will take you quickly through several basic settings on the
TV, including Menu Language, Time Zone, DST on/o, Time
Format, Air/Cable and Auto Scan.
For each of the rst three menus, press the qp buttons to
highlight each setting to be adjusted, then use t u to make
the adjustment. When you’re nished with the adjustments on
a submenu, press q to highlight Go to Next Step, then press
t or u to go to the next screen of the Setup Wizard.
When you have nished with the third Setup Wizard screen,
the Setup Wizard will automatically activate Auto Scan to
identify and memorize the channels that can be received.
